WebPremature ventricular contractions (PVCs) are a type of abnormal heartbeat. Your heart has 4 chambers: 2 upper atria and 2 lower ventricles. Normally, a special group of cells start the signal for your heartbeat. ... PVCs can cause symptoms, but often they don't. When they happen only once in a while, PVCs don't need treatment.
